Description
The Massachusetts Association of Crime Analysts has hosted an annual training conference for 23 years, gathering analysts, officers and command staff from across New England and throughout the country for five days of world class training. We have subject matter experts teaching breakout sessions and national leaders in policing giving the keynote addresses.
This year, we are looking forward to returning to in-person training after canceling 2020 and 2021 due to the COVID-19 pandemic.
We are excited that our conference is moving to a new venue in historic downtown Plymouth, Massachusetts. We are also thrilled to partner with NESPIN this year, bringing their top notch training and technical assistance to our attendees.
